is a specialized, 64-bit custom rescue platform built on the Windows Preinstallation Environment Special Edition (PESE) . It provides a full graphical desktop environment directly from system RAM, allowing IT technicians and system administrators to troubleshoot, repair, and deploy Windows operating systems offline. Unlike the stock Microsoft WinPE command-line interface, WinPESE-x64 features a recognizable Windows user interface complete with file explorers, diagnostic software, and recovery scripts. As modern hardware moves away from Legacy BIOS toward UEFI, having an (64-bit) preinstallation environment is critical. Many newer machines cannot boot 32-bit (x86) media, making Win-PESE x64 the standard choice for modern laptop and desktop recovery. It ensures compatibility with larger memory capacities and provides the necessary drivers for contemporary NVMe storage and network adapters. Win10PE SE is a project based on the WinBuilder engine that allows you to create a customized "Preinstallation Environment." Unlike the bare-bones command prompt you get from a standard Windows recovery USB, this x64 environment provides a familiar graphical interface, file explorer, and support for running 64-bit applications directly from a bootable drive.
